
在选择WinCC数据库管理软件时,有多个可供选择的选项,它们在功能和应用上具有不同的优势。
1、WinCC内置数据库管理系统:WinCC自带的数据库系统主要是通过Microsoft SQL Server进行数据存储和管理,具有强大的数据处理能力和扩展性。
2、第三方数据库连接插件:除了WinCC自带的SQL Server,WinCC还支持通过插件连接到其他数据库,如MySQL、Oracle等。这些插件使得WinCC能够与不同的数据库系统进行集成,扩展其功能。
一、WinCC内置数据库管理功能
WinCC的内置数据库管理系统采用了Microsoft SQL Server,这是最常用的一种数据库管理工具,广泛应用于自动化领域。它能够帮助用户存储和管理工业数据、运行历史记录等信息。WinCC的SQL Server数据库具有如下特点:
- 数据存储:所有的监控数据,包括实时数据、报警记录、事件日志等,都可以存储在SQL Server中。通过数据库管理系统,可以轻松检索、查询和操作这些数据。
- 可扩展性:SQL Server不仅能存储大量数据,而且能够根据实际需求扩展,支持大规模的数据处理。对于数据的查询与分析,有非常强的支持能力。
- 备份和恢复:数据库的备份和恢复功能可以有效防止数据丢失,确保系统的稳定运行。
二、第三方数据库管理系统
除了WinCC内置的数据库系统,WinCC还支持与多个第三方数据库进行集成,允许用户根据需要选择最合适的数据库系统。常见的第三方数据库管理系统包括:
1、MySQL
- 开源:MySQL是一个开源的关系型数据库管理系统,价格较低,且容易进行定制和扩展。
- 高效能:MySQL支持大规模数据的处理,适合处理复杂的查询和操作,尤其是在大数据量环境下有良好的表现。
2、Oracle
- 高可用性:Oracle数据库提供了高可用性和强大的数据完整性保障,适用于需要高可靠性和性能的场合。
- 高级功能:Oracle数据库内置了多种企业级功能,如数据压缩、并行查询等,适合大规模数据和复杂应用的场合。
3、SQLite
- 轻量级:SQLite是一款轻量级的数据库管理系统,非常适合嵌入式系统和小规模数据存储。
- 无需服务器:SQLite不需要独立的数据库服务器,所有的数据都保存在一个本地文件中,安装简单,适合一些低成本应用。
三、如何选择WinCC数据库管理软件
在选择合适的数据库管理软件时,需要根据以下几个因素进行考虑:
1、数据量大小:如果您的项目需要存储大量的历史数据,建议选择SQL Server或者Oracle,这些数据库能提供更高的扩展性和处理能力。
2、预算和成本:MySQL和SQLite通常比SQL Server和Oracle便宜或者免费,如果预算较紧张,可以考虑选择这类数据库管理系统。
3、集成需求:如果您的企业系统已经使用某一特定类型的数据库,可以选择相应的插件进行集成,以实现无缝对接。
四、总结
选择合适的数据库管理系统对于WinCC的应用至关重要。WinCC自带的SQL Server提供了强大的功能和稳定性,是工业自动化中常用的数据库管理系统。同时,MySQL和Oracle等第三方数据库也提供了更多的选择,适应不同的项目需求。在实际应用中,企业可以根据数据量大小、预算以及集成需求来选择最合适的数据库管理系统。
若您需要进一步了解如何在WinCC中配置和管理数据库,可以访问简道云官网:简道云官网获取更多信息。
相关问答FAQs:
1. 什么是WinCC数据库管理软件?
WinCC(Windows Control Center)是一种广泛应用于工业自动化领域的监控和控制软件,常用于数据采集和监控系统。它支持与多种数据库的集成,以便于数据的存储、管理和分析。WinCC数据库管理软件的主要功能包括实时数据采集、历史数据记录、报警管理、趋势分析和报表生成等。通过与数据库的结合,用户能够更高效地管理和利用生产数据,从而提升整体运营效率。
2. WinCC数据库管理软件有哪些常见类型?
WinCC与多种数据库系统兼容,用户可以根据实际需求选择合适的数据库管理软件。常见的数据库管理软件包括:
-
Microsoft SQL Server:这是最常用的数据库管理软件之一,具有强大的数据处理能力和安全性,适合大规模数据的管理。WinCC可以与SQL Server无缝集成,支持实时数据的存储和查询。
-
MySQL:开源的关系型数据库管理系统,适合中小型企业使用。MySQL以其灵活性和高性能受到广泛青睐,尤其适合需要高并发读写的场景。
-
Oracle Database:高性能的企业级数据库解决方案,适用于需要强大数据处理能力和复杂查询的应用场合。WinCC与Oracle的结合可以为企业提供更高的数据安全性和完整性。
-
PostgreSQL:同样是一个开源的对象关系型数据库,以其强大的功能和扩展性受到欢迎。PostgreSQL适用于复杂的数据模型和大规模数据的处理,能够与WinCC集成,为用户提供灵活的数据管理能力。
3. 如何选择合适的WinCC数据库管理软件?
选择合适的WinCC数据库管理软件需要考虑多方面的因素,包括企业的规模、数据处理需求、预算和技术支持等。以下是一些建议:
-
企业规模:对于大中型企业,Microsoft SQL Server或Oracle Database可能是更合适的选择,因为它们能够处理大量数据并提供更高级的功能。而对于小型企业,MySQL或PostgreSQL可能更具成本效益。
-
数据处理需求:如果企业需要处理复杂的数据关系和大规模的并发访问,Oracle Database或PostgreSQL可能是最佳选择;如果需求相对简单,MySQL和SQL Server也能够满足大部分需求。
-
预算:开源数据库(如MySQL和PostgreSQL)通常没有许可证费用,适合预算有限的企业。而商业数据库(如SQL Server和Oracle)虽然功能强大,但需要考虑许可证费用和维护成本。
-
技术支持:选择数据库管理软件时,必须考虑技术支持的可用性。对于缺乏专业技术人员的企业,选择一个提供良好技术支持的数据库供应商将有助于确保系统的顺利运行。
通过以上的分析,企业可以根据自身的实际情况,选择最适合的WinCC数据库管理软件,以实现高效的数据管理和利用。
推荐:分享一个好用的业务管理系统,注册直接试用:
https://www.jiandaoyun.com/register?utm_src=wzseonl
100+企业管理系统模板免费使用>>>无需下载,在线安装:
https://s.fanruan.com/7wtn5
阅读时间:8 分钟
浏览量:9897次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








